Coyote Ridge Golf Club
About
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
---|---|---|---|---|
Black | 72 | 7003 yards | 75.2 | 141 |
Blue | 72 | 6344 yards | 72.0 | 135 |
White | 72 | 5861 yards | 69.3 | 131 |
Red (W) | 72 | 5096 yards | 71.4 | 123 |

Current Under Repair
I’m a regular at this course (play about 10 times a year)
Typically this course is in very good shape, with the greens being some of the best north of 635.
Currently though, the course is going through winter woes, and the superintended is taking advantage and redoing 70%+ of the bunkers.
The problem, the course doesn’t acknowledge that much of the holes are under various stages of improvement, and it drastically impacts the play. Worse, the construction crew (not Coyote employees) have zero respect/understanding of course etiquette. Interrupting tee shots, driving across and through the fair way. Not allowing for shots before starting/moving equipment.
At a minimum, Coyote management should warn/ban the crews they are using if they can’t get their act together. After talking to the clubhouse attendant, apparently this is an ongoing issue and I consider that to be unacceptable.
All and all, I will not be going back until the course improvements are complete.

Avoid after heavy rain
My only words of warning are that this course does not drain particularly well. As such, for two or three days after a heavy rain, the tee boxes, fairways and bunkers will be extremely soggy. Otherwise, it's a nice course and well maintained.

Worth it if you can get a Hot Deal
This is a fantastic course… just ask them! Hole locations were very tough today.
If you can get it on a hot deal for 40 or 50 bucks it is well worth it. For $70 it’s fair, and more than that… look elsewhere. Greens are always true and challenging. The layout is great and very scenic for flat north Texas. I enjoy playing this course and it is always a challenge but, it will reward accurate shots.

Good Course, No Marshals
Course is in impeccable shape! One hole was under construction but it was indicated ahead of time so that’s no issue.
The problem was that, despite being 17 holes, the round took 5.5 hours. The starter even acknowledged at the beginning that the group two groups ahead was low skill and that it would ‘be a long day’. If the starter knows this, why was no marshal around to keep the pace of play?
I feel like this is a fixable issue for a course that costs $100 per round.
